Claims (10)
- ポリイミドキャリア(202)の第一および第二の側面の上に第一の摩擦低減層(208)および第二の摩擦低減層(214)をキャスティングする工程と、
前記第一および第二の摩擦低減層を被覆する第一の接着剤層(210)および第二の接着剤層(216)をキャスティングして、第一の多層キャストフィルム(204)および第二の多層キャストフィルム(206)を形成する工程と、
前記第一および第二の多層キャストフィルム(204,206)を第一および第二の支持基材に対して、それぞれの支持基材が、前記対応する摩擦低減層に対してよりも前記対応する接着剤層に対してより近くなるように積層して接着し、第一および第二の複合体を形成する工程と、
前記複合体をブッシュに成形する工程と、
を含む、ブッシュを製造する方法。 - 前記摩擦低減層をキャスティングする工程が、ポリマー分散体を前記キャリアに塗布する工程、前記ポリマー分散体を乾燥させてポリマー層を形成する工程、および前記ポリマー層をシンターさせる工程を含む、請求項1に記載の方法。
- 同時に前記第一および第二の摩擦低減層を、塗布し、乾燥させ、シンターさせる、請求項1に記載の方法。
- 第一の表面を有する支持基材と、
前記支持基材の前記第一の表面に積層させたキャストフルオロポリマーフィルムであって、前記キャストフルオロポリマーフィルムが、摩擦低減層および接着剤層を含み、前記支持基材が、前記摩擦低減層に対してよりも前記接着剤層に対してより近くに配置され、
前記キャストフルオロポリマーフィルムが、前記摩擦低減層と前記接着層の間に1層又は複数のフルオロポリマー層を含み、前記摩擦低減層が当該1層又は複数のフルオロポリマー層と異なる潤滑特性を有している、キャストフルオロポリマーフィルムと、
を含み、
前記接着剤層が、フルオロポリマー、エポキシ樹脂、ポリイミド樹脂、アクリレート、ポリエーテル/ポリアミドコポリマー、エチレン酢酸ビニル、およびそれらの任意の組み合わせからなる群より選択されるポリマーを含むブッシュ。 - 前記摩擦低減層が、フルオロポリマーを含む、請求項4に記載のブッシュ。
- 前記フルオロポリマーが、ポリテトラフルオロエチレン、フッ素化エチレン−プロピレン、ポリビニリデンフルオリド、ポリクロロトリフルオロエチレン、エチレンクロロトリフルオロエチレン、ペルフルオロアルコキシポリマー、およびそれらの任意の組み合わせからなる群より選択される、請求項5に記載のブッシュ。
- 前記摩擦低減層が、摩擦低減性充填剤を含む、請求項5に記載のブッシュ。
- 前記摩擦低減性充填剤が、ガラス繊維、炭素繊維、ケイ素、グラファイト、ポリエーテルエーテルケトン、二硫化モリブデン、芳香族ポリエステル、炭素粒子、青銅、フルオロポリマー、熱可塑性プラスチック充填剤、鉱物質充填剤、およびそれらの任意の組み合わせからなる群より選択される、請求項7に記載のブッシュ。
- 前記摩擦低減層が、0.4以下の摩擦係数を有する、請求項4に記載のブッシュ。
- 追加のフルオロポリマー層が、前記ブッシュを交換する時間の信号を発するための信号充填剤を含む、請求項4に記載のブッシュ。
